Transaction 627c449fece6b6aedc50fb6d17293626cc49f2d71b6d2f6ba184dd56416c92cc
1 Input
1 Outputs
- 627c449fece6b6aedc50fb6d17293626cc49f2d71b6d2f6ba184dd56416c92cc:0
value 58534028
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G